India, Aug. 7 -- While the Indian Medical Association (IMA) announced its withdrawal from the strike in the Bombay High Court without even waiting for its order, the Maharashtra Association of Resident Doctors (MARD) stated that it would continue with the protest through "constitutional, legal and democratic means" until its concerns were appropriately addressed. Post the court hearing, a persistent MARD went ahead to meet the medical education department officials and even the chief minister, hoping to find a way out.
